Transaction 503975d8356c857a4962c18b46ae7b637c21e313c711efda660dfcbbfdaf4930

1 Input
2 Outputs
  • 503975d8356c857a4962c18b46ae7b637c21e313c711efda660dfcbbfdaf4930:0
  • value  13392000
    address  12NHh17cgZ3bescrKaAJDJfGWFX1EKbh2Z
  • 503975d8356c857a4962c18b46ae7b637c21e313c711efda660dfcbbfdaf4930:1
  • value  9567887370
    address  1DcKsGnjpD38bfj6RMxz945YwohZUTVLby